ppokorny 00cc9fca23 + Changed protocol to 0.3 because we now accept both -foo and foo
as argument introducers.  in 0.4-pre10, these were changed
   from foo to -foo and this broke many clients.  This change
   should fix that and be backward/forward compatible.
 + Added a noop function to the protocol.  This is useful for writing
   shell script clients of LCDproc.
 + Changed the shared sock_send_string function to NOT send the
   ending NUL ('\0') byte with the string.  This was confusing
   in Perl clients which saw NUL's as the first character of
   each reply.  WARNING: The LCDPROC client depended on this
   behavior, your client may too.  Use the newline instead.
   See the code in clients/lcdproc/main.c (look for "switch(buf[i])")
   to see one way to handle this.  This should allow new clients
   to connect to old servers and vice-versa.
 + Messed with include structure in .c files.  It should no longer
   be necessary to specify ../.. to get to shared code headers.
   Also, since we are using automake, the global config.h can be
   found with just #include "config.h" as it's location is included
   in a -I to the compilers.  As a result "make distcheck" now works.

/////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
// Changes screen contrast (0-255; 140 seems good)
// note: works only for LCD displays
// Is it better to use the brightness for VFD/VKD displays ?
//
int
MtxOrb_contrast (int contrast)
{
char out[4];
static int status = 140;
if ( ((MtxOrb_type == MTXORB_LCD) || (MtxOrb_type == MTXORB_LKD)) &&
(contrast > 0) ) {
status = contrast;
sprintf (out, "%cP%c", 254, status);
write (fd, out, 3);
}
return status;
}
/////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
// Sets the backlight on or off -- can be done quickly for
// an intermediate brightness...
// WARN: off switches vfd/vkd displays off
// -> so it's maybe the best to start LCDd with -b on
//
void
MtxOrb_backlight (int on)
{
char out[4];
if (on) {
sprintf (out, "%cB%c", 254, 0);
write (fd, out, 3);
} else {
sprintf (out, "%cF", 254);
write (fd, out, 2);
}
}
/////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
// Sets output port on or off
// displays with keypad have 6 outputs but the one without kepad
// have only one output
// NOTE: length of command are different
void
MtxOrb_output (int on)
{
char out[5];
if ( ((MtxOrb_type == MTXORB_LCD) || (MtxOrb_type == MTXORB_VFD)) ) {
if (on) {
sprintf (out, "%cW", 254);
} else {
sprintf (out, "%cV", 254);
}
write (fd, out, 2);
} else {
int i;
for(i=0; i<6; i++) {
if ( on & (1 << i) ) {
sprintf (out, "%cW%c", 254, i+1);
} else {
sprintf (out, "%cV%c", 254, i+1);
}
write (fd, out, 3);
}
}
}
/////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
// Toggle the built-in linewrapping feature
//
static void
MtxOrb_linewrap (int on)
{
char out[4];
if (on)
sprintf (out, "%cC", 254);
else
sprintf (out, "%cD", 254);
write (fd, out, 2);
}
/////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
// Toggle the built-in automatic scrolling feature
//
static void
MtxOrb_autoscroll (int on)
{
char out[4];
if (on)
sprintf (out, "%cQ", 254);
else
sprintf (out, "%cR", 254);
write (fd, out, 2);
}
// TODO: make sure this doesn't mess up non-VFD displays
/////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
// Toggle cursor blink on/off
//
static void
MtxOrb_cursorblink (int on)
{
char out[4];
if (on)
sprintf (out, "%cS", 254);
else
sprintf (out, "%cT", 254);
write (fd, out, 2);
}

// TODO: This could be higly optimised if data where to be pre-computed.
/////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
// Sets a custom character from 0-7...
//
// For input, values > 0 mean "on" and values <= 0 are "off".
//
// The input is just an array of characters...
//
void
MtxOrb_set_char (int n, char *dat)
{
char out[4];
int row, col;
int letter;
if (n < 0 || n > 7)
return;
if (!dat)
return;
sprintf (out, "%cN%c", 254, n);
write (fd, out, 3);
for (row = 0; row < lcd.cellhgt; row++) {
letter = 0;
for (col = 0; col < lcd.cellwid; col++) {
letter <<= 1;
letter |= (dat[(row * lcd.cellwid) + col] > 0);
}
write (fd, &letter, 1);
}
}

/////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
// Ask for dynamic allocation of a custom caracter to be
// a well none bar graphic. The function is suppose to
// return a value between 0 and 7 but 0 is reserver for
// heart beat.
// This function manadge a cache of graphical caracter in use.
// I really hope it is working and bug-less because it is not
// completely tested, just a quick hack.
//
int
MtxOrb_ask_bar (int type)
{
int i;
int last_not_in_use;
int pos; // 0 is icon, 1 to 7 are free, 8 is not found.
// TODO: Reuse graphic caracter 0 if heartbeat is not in use.
// REMOVE: fprintf(stderr, "GLU: MtxOrb_ask_bar(%d).\n", type);
// Check if the screen was clear.
if (clear) { // If the screen was clear then graphic caracter are not in use.
//REMOVE: fprintf(stderr, "GLU: MtxOrb_ask_bar| clear was set.\n");
use[0] = 1; // Heartbeat is always in use (not true but it help).
for (pos = 1; pos < 8; pos++) {
use[pos] = 0; // Other are not in use.
}
clear = 0; // We made the special treatement.
} else {
// Nothing special if some caracter a curently in use (...) ?
}
// Search for a match with caracter already defined.
pos = 8; // Not found.
last_not_in_use = 8; // No empty slot to reuse.
for (i = 1; i < 8; i++) { // For all but first (heartbeat).
if (!use[i])
last_not_in_use = i; // New empty slot.
if (def[i] == type)
pos = i; // Founded (should break now).
}
if (pos == 8) {
// REMOVE: fprintf(stderr, "GLU: MtxOrb_ask_bar| not found.\n");
pos = last_not_in_use;
// TODO: Best match/deep search is no more graphic caracter are available.
}
if (pos != 8) { // A caracter is found (Best match could solve our problem).
// REMOVE: fprintf(stderr, "GLU: MtxOrb_ask_bar| found at %d.\n", pos);
if (def[pos] != type) {
MtxOrb_set_known_char (pos, type); // Define a new graphic caracter.
def[pos] = type; // Remember that now the caracter is available.
}
if (!use[pos]) { // If the caracter is no yet in use (but defined).
use[pos] = 1; // Remember it is in use (so protect it from re-use).
}
}
